The image depicts an interior room in Ankpa, Nigeria. The walls are covered in black and gold damask-patterned wallpaper. A white suspended ceiling with a visible grid is present overhead. The floor is tiled in a reddish-brown color. A flat-screen television is mounted on the central wall, displaying content that includes a dark silhouette of a person, along with text elements like "GIVERS T" and "NAIJACEE SLM TV." Below the television, a black shelf holds a media player or set-top box. Numerous black cables are visible, running from the television and associated devices, creating a tangle against the wallpaper. To the right of the television, a yellow device labeled "Wan King" with a digital display and control buttons is mounted on the wall; this appears to be a power inverter or solar charge controller. A white triple-gang electrical outlet with switches is installed lower on the right wall. On the upper left wall, near the ceiling, a single fluorescent tube light fixture is mounted horizontally. Further left, a circular, segmented decorative object is partially visible on the wall. A dark, possibly black or brown, beaded curtain hangs vertically on the far left, partially obscuring an opening. In the lower right foreground, the arm and shoulder of a person, dressed in dark clothing, are visible, suggesting they are seated out of frame, facing the television. A dark object, possibly a bag, rests on the floor in the lower left, near the beaded curtain.
